Whether seen on HBO’s Treme or at their legendary Tuesday
night gig at The Maple Leaf, Grammy-winning Rebirth Brass Band is a true New
Orleans institution. Formed in 1983 by the Frazier brothers, the band has
evolved from playing the streets of the French Quarter to playing festivals and
stages all over the world. While committed to upholding the tradition of brass
bands, they have also extended themselves into the realms of funk and hip-hop
to create their signature sound.
Following the Grammy-winning Rebirth of New Orleans,
Rebirth Brass Band is at it again with Move Your Body, an infectious,
groove-laden collection of hip-shakers sure to saturate the dance floor. Rollicking
originals like "Who's Rockin, Who's Rollin'"? and "Take 'Em to
the Moon" reaffirm the band's position as head of the brass throne while
the rasta-esque "On My Way" and leave-nothing-to-the-imagination
lyrics of "HBNS" showcase the unit's talent for penning unabashed
party starters. Boasting a mastery of Rebirth's signature "heavy
funk" sound, Move Your Body pushes and swings, leaving behind an 11 track
thumbprint, approved by the Frazier brothers themselves, of a sultry Tuesday
night spent dancing on their home court at the Maple Leaf Bar in New Orleans.
